About Moroccan Rap
Emerging from the vibrant urban landscapes of Casablanca and Tangier in the late 1980s, Moroccan Rap blends classic hip-hop foundations with traditional Maghrebi musicality. The genre is characterized by rhythmic structures that frequently incorporate elements of Gnawa and Rai, often featuring instrumentation such as the oud alongside modern digital drum machines and heavy basslines. Lyrically, it serves as a powerful medium for social commentary and youth expression, delivered in Moroccan Darija with high-energy flows that range from gritty boom-bap to contemporary trap aesthetics. This fusion creates a unique sonic identity that bridges North African heritage with the global urban movement, maintaining a mood that oscillates between defiant socio-political resistance and rhythmic celebration.
Also known as: Moroccan Hip Hop, Rap Maghribi
